Who conducts the selection for interviews?
Applicants who possess the preferred skills are forwarded to the Hiring Manager who schedules and conducts selection interview(s) and determines if an offer will be extended to any of the candidates. If the position requires testing, you will be contacted by Human Resources to schedule a test date.
Once a conditional offer has been extended to a candidate and the offer is accepted, the on-boarding process begins. This process can include: background check, reference check, employment and education verification, physical, drug screen, and psychological depending upon the position.
